Earlier in November, two more statues were added to Legends Row outside the Air Canada Centre, Syl Apps and George Armstrong. Both men were Maple Leaf Captains and both men wore jersey number 10.

below: An old photo showing Syl Apps and a young George Armstrong when the latter was given Maple Leaf jersey 10 to wear. Armstrong was the first player to wear number 10 since Apps had retired.
below: George Armstrong, past and present, at the unveiling. Armstrong played 21 seasons with the Maple Leafs between 1950 and 1971. After retiring from playing hockey, he coached the Toronto Marlies for a few seasons and he was on the Maple Leaf scouting staff for many years.
below: Also, number 10, Syl Apps joined the Maple Leafs in 1936. While he was captain of the Maple Leafs, the team won three Stanley Cups. Apps retired in 1948.
